タグ

関連タグで絞り込む (1)

タグの絞り込みを解除

+architectureと*developmentに関するyamaedaのブックマーク (3)

  • DCIアーキテクチャ - Trygve Reenskaug and James O. Coplien - Digital Romanticism

    この記事はartima developerに掲載されている、Trygve Reenskaug氏とJames O. Coplien氏による記事「The DCI Architecture: A New Vision of Object-Oriented Programming」を、著作権者であるBill Bennrs氏の許可を得て翻訳したものです。文内の図の著作権はArtima, Inc.に帰属します。(原文公開日:2009年3月20日) 要約 オブジェクト指向プログラミングはプログラマとエンドユーザの視点をコンピュータコードにおいて統一するものと考えられていた。この恩恵はユーザビリティとプログラムの分かりやすさの両面にわたる。しかし、オブジェクトは構造をとらえるのに長けている一方で、システムの動作をとらえることができていない。DCIはエンドユーザのロールに関する認識モデルとロール間の関係を

    DCIアーキテクチャ - Trygve Reenskaug and James O. Coplien - Digital Romanticism
  • SOAP童貞を卒業する - Yet Another Ranha

    今回は、初めてのSOAPプログラミングを何も知識が無いままやってみると成功したので、それについて書こうと思います。 そもそも、SOAPとは何か。 SOAP (プロトコル) - Wikipedia 簡単に言うと、XML-RPCの凄い版という事になるのでしょうか? 少なくともXMLスキーマで、何かしらのプロトコルの上に乗せて飛ばします。XML-RPCと同じくHTTPが多いようですが、その限りでは無いようです。 突然ですが、今日の夕方頃から私が始めた事は一見SOAPと全く関係が無い様に見えた事でした。 何をやり始めたのか・・・ですが、前日のエントリにちらっと出したUPnPです。 話をいきなり脱線させて、UPnPについて述べる事にします。 UPnPとは?? http://ja.wikipedia.org/wiki/UPnP http://bb.watch.impress.co.jp/cda/bbw

    SOAP童貞を卒業する - Yet Another Ranha
  • ActionWebServiceでxmlrpcサービスを作る - 2nd life (移転しました)

    下が変な人に「くれりんこ」と云われたような気もするので作り方を解説します。 RailsではActionWebServiceを使うとxmlrpcやsoapのサービスを簡単に作ることができます。今回はTraipyという以前実装したTropyクローンに簡単にxmlrpcで投稿(newTropy)、エントリーの取得(getTropy)をできるAPIを実装してみましょう。 まずAPIのライブラリを置く場所ですが、Rails的にはRAILS_ROOT/app/apis/*_api.rbとして置くのが一般的です。今回はxmlrpc_api.rbという名前を付けて配置します。 module XmlrpcStruct class Tropy < ActionWebService::Struct member :key, :string member :source, :string end end cla

    ActionWebServiceでxmlrpcサービスを作る - 2nd life (移転しました)
  • 1